Like the Banks-Solander track, the Burrawang walk begins at theย Kurnell Visitor Centre.
This easy walk tells the story of the first meeting of European and Aboriginal culture. A soundscape, featuring Aboriginal language, children laughing and clap sticks will have you feeling like you’ve stepped back in time and give you a sense of the strong Aboriginal connection to Country.
The Burrawang walk takes you past several of the areaโs historic sites, including the welcome wall, the freshwater stream, the meeting place, Banksโ Memorial, Ferry Shelter Shed and Captain Cookโs Landing Place.
Along the route, youโll see several interpretive signs outlining the parkโs cultural and natural history.
